How is the area of a rectangle related to the area of a triangle?

Answer:the area of arectangle is twice that of a triangle with in it if separated by the diagonal

Step-by-step explanation:when drawing a diagonal two triangles of equal sizes are formed draw another diagonal from the opposite side four triangles are formed
